Although there are HD, they come in different sizes. This is often found in the formulation of 1080p, 1080i, 720P, 720I and models. The I stands for interlaced, and in reality it is a technology CRT TV days. It is useless for the needs of today’s fast computers. The P stands for progressive and is the latest cutting edge. However, it is more expensive than interlaced. Although, if your budget allows, get by any means progressive. The other number that is found – 720 or 1080 is the two numbers that stand for the format and the resolution of HDTV. The higher the better, and in this case, the 1080p models of the current winner. The problem with 1080p sets is that they are the most expensive from all different areas. So, it’s something to consider before buying.
